Around 100 correctional officers, K-9 handlers and instructors descended on northern Arizona in September for annual dog handler training with Arizonas Department of Corrections (DOC) K-9 units, tactical team and chase teams. January 9, 2019 Sixteen NYC Department of Correction K9s will receive bullet and stab protective vests, thanks to a charitable donation from a non-profit organization dedicated to protecting Americas law enforcement dogs. The BLS reports that the federal government pays the highest annual wage to police officers at $92,080, followed by state governments at $70,280 and local governments at $65,850. Departments utilizing single-purpose dogs (scent work only) still have a need for K-9 teams who exercise appropriate discretion with regard to searches and seizures, especially when non-offender entities are involved, such as visitors, staff or other members of the public.
